package org.apache.qpid.url;
import java.util.Collections;
import java.util.Map;
import java.util.Set;
public class URLHelper
{
public static final char DEFAULT_OPTION_SEPERATOR = '&';
public static final char ALTERNATIVE_OPTION_SEPARATOR = ',';
public static final char BROKER_SEPARATOR = ';';
private URLHelper()
{
}
public static void parseOptions(Map<String, String> optionMap, String options) throws URLSyntaxException
{
if ((options == null) || (options.indexOf('=') == -1))
{
return;
}
int optionIndex = options.indexOf('=');
String option = options.substring(0, optionIndex);
int length = options.length();
int nestedQuotes = 0;
// to store index of final "'"
int valueIndex = optionIndex;
// Walk remainder of url.
while ((nestedQuotes > 0) || (valueIndex < length))
{
valueIndex++;
if (valueIndex >= length)
{
break;
}
if (options.charAt(valueIndex) == '\'')
{
if ((valueIndex + 1) < options.length())
{
if ((options.charAt(valueIndex + 1) == DEFAULT_OPTION_SEPERATOR)
|| (options.charAt(valueIndex + 1) == ALTERNATIVE_OPTION_SEPARATOR)
|| (options.charAt(valueIndex + 1) == BROKER_SEPARATOR)
|| (options.charAt(valueIndex + 1) == '\''))
{
nestedQuotes--;
if (nestedQuotes == 0)
{
// We've found the value of an option
break;
}
}
else
{
nestedQuotes++;
}
}
else
{
// We are at the end of the string
// Check to see if we are corectly closing quotes
if (options.charAt(valueIndex) == '\'')
{
nestedQuotes--;
}
break;
}
}
}
if ((nestedQuotes != 0) || (valueIndex < (optionIndex + 2)))
{
int sepIndex = 0;
// Try and identify illegal separator character
if (nestedQuotes > 1)
{
for (int i = 0; i < nestedQuotes; i++)
{
sepIndex = options.indexOf('\'', sepIndex);
sepIndex++;
}
}
if ((sepIndex >= options.length()) || (sepIndex == 0))
{
throw parseError(valueIndex, "Unterminated option", options);
}
else
{
throw parseError(sepIndex, "Unterminated option. Possible illegal option separator:'"
+ options.charAt(sepIndex) + "'", options);
}
}
// optionIndex +2 to skip "='"
String value = options.substring(optionIndex + 2, valueIndex);
optionMap.put(option, value);
if (valueIndex < (options.length() - 1))
{
// Recurse to get remaining options
parseOptions(optionMap, options.substring(valueIndex + 2));
}
}
public static URLSyntaxException parseError(int index, String error, String url)
{
return parseError(index, 1, error, url);
}
public static URLSyntaxException parseError(int index, int length, String error, String url)
{
return new URLSyntaxException(url, error, index, length);
}
public static String printOptions(Map<String, String> options)
{
return printOptions(options, Collections.<String>emptySet());
}
public static String printOptions(Map<String, String> options, Set<String> optionNamesToMask)
{
if (options.isEmpty())
{
return "";
}
else
{
StringBuilder sb = new StringBuilder();
sb.append('?');
for (Map.Entry<String,String> entry : options.entrySet())
{
sb.append(entry.getKey());
sb.append("='");
if (optionNamesToMask.contains(entry.getKey()))
{
sb.append("********");
}
else
{
sb.append(entry.getValue());
}
sb.append("'");
sb.append(DEFAULT_OPTION_SEPERATOR);
}
sb.deleteCharAt(sb.length() - 1);
return sb.toString();
}
}
}
